**Subject: Consent banner rollout — go/no-go**

Team — the Wrenfield consent banner is at 25% and holding. Dismiss rates are within expected range, no spike in support tickets, and the preference service is handling load fine. Legal signed off on the updated copy yesterday. Plan: bump to 50% tomorrow morning, 100% by Thursday if metrics stay flat. One known cosmetic issue on narrow viewports; fix rides the next patch train. RM, please approve the ramp. The candidate build token for the 50% stage follows.

pipeline stamp: htk4_4d6a

## Retrying Failed Exports

Exports from Ledgerbarn retry three times with exponential backoff, then land in the dead-letter queue. Replay via `POST /exports/{id}/retry` on the Fennwick internal API. Idempotency is keyed on export ID, so duplicate replays are safe. The retry endpoint authenticates with the key below.

API key for kahop-bagef: zpat2_yb

**Rendering Pipeline — Support Basics**

Quillpress converts customer markdown to HTML via the Inkrun workers. Failed renders land in the dead-letter view; retry once before escalating. Do not edit sanitizer rules yourself. Known issue: nested tables drop styling. For escalations beyond a single retry, contact the pipeline maintainers at the address below.

escalation mailbox, fafof-bahip: tamael@ordincorp.test

Handing off the Quillbus broker upgrade (4.x to 5.1) to Dario. Cluster is half-migrated; mixed-version mode is supported but TLS cert rotation must finish before cutover. No auth model changes, though the admin API gained two new endpoints worth reviewing. Open questions and the migration checklist are tracked on the internal page below.

dashboard of taduf-bawef = https://jira.lumicsys.internal/projects/display/browse/b1cbf89d